Am I eligible to give Preliminary Exam of UPSC being a student of final year B.Sc? Required percentage of marks in Graduation for this?


I am a BSC final year student. Am i eligible to give UPSC preliminary exam. What is the required percentage in graduation for appearing

There is no percentage of marks required for UPSC Civil Service Examination.

Civil Service Examination conducted by UPSC every year for recruitment to the top post in various administrative Dept. of Govt. of India.

The eligible candidate must be an Indian National having appeared for the final graduation degree exam or passed from any stream of education from a recognised University within the age of 21 to 30 years age. The upper age is relaxed for OBC category candidate up to 3 years and that for SC/ST/PH category up to 5 years, is eligible to apply for Civil Service Exam. There is no requirement of any percentage of marks for application to Civil Service exam.

The selection is through three phases:-

CSAT- Civil Service Aptitude Test- Preliminary exam which comprises of all objective tupe questions.

Civil Service Main Exam. which comprises of all subjective type questions.

Personal Interview.

With the above qualification criteria you can attempt this exam four times according to your age if you are a general candidate which is up to 7 attempts in case of OBC candidate and no such limits for SCC/ST/PH category candidates.

Eligibility For UPSC Preliminary Exam


The UPSC Preliminary Exam is also known as the CSAT (Civil Services Aptitude Test) is the first stage of the Civil Services Exam conducted for the recruitment for IAS,IPS,etc..

Eligibility Criterion For Appearing in Civil Service Exam:-

1) All the candidates who have completed their graduation from a recognized University or are in the final year of graduation are eligible for appearing in the exam..

2) The candidates must also be within the age limit of 21-30 years if belonging to general category,21-33 years if OBC and 21-35 if SC/ST..

3) The maximum number of attempts allowed for the general candidates is 4, 7 for OBC and no restriction on the number of attempts for the SC/ST/PWD..


Provided that you are within the prescribed age limit..you are eligible for appearing in the Prelims Exam as you are in the final year of your graduation..

Exam Pattern :-

The Prelims will consist of 2 papers which will test you mainly on General Awareness and Aptitude Skills..

The Mains however, shall consist of 9 subjective papers which will test you on the knowledge of your graduation as well as English..

The forms for the Civil Service Exam in 2012 shall release on 4th February,2012 and the last date for submission of the form is 5th March,2012..

The Prelims will be conducted on 20th May,2012 and the Mains shall be conducted on 5th October,2012..
